Output 73bba2d2b5662a543ed03e07da624726e32176257d0e3cdd56e87e16a76d0504:2

value
956341
script pubkey
OP_0 OP_PUSHBYTES_20 95ca4d642ee40bf4917df5adc8e0803f1ff1b015
address
tb1qjh9y6epwus9lfyta7kku3cyq8u0lrvq466ufmk
transaction
73bba2d2b5662a543ed03e07da624726e32176257d0e3cdd56e87e16a76d0504